It could be less if you leverage the support in the underlying host OS => windows/linux/macos.
Isn't it (in a certain way) what the NICOF program of Hans Latz was doing? I remember there was a disconnected virtual machine TCPIPXY running on VM/370 and a Java machine on the host connecting to it.
Personally, I liked NICOF quite much, although it was probably not very secure (and never pretended to be if I am right). NICOF does not work on VM/370 CE anymore. Someone told me that the connection between the Java machine and the TCPIPXY virtual machine gets confused by the SYSNAME added in Sixpack 1.3. But It could be something else.
